Pre-Market Overview

Before the official opening bell, the pre-market session offers a sneak peek into potential market movements. Pre-market trading often reflects overnight news, economic data releases, and global market activity. Monitoring this period can help you anticipate the day's trends and adjust your strategy accordingly. Significant corporate earnings reports released before the opening bell can heavily influence individual stock prices and overall market sentiment. For instance, if a major tech company announces earnings that significantly exceed expectations, its stock price will likely jump in pre-market trading, potentially lifting the broader market as well. Conversely, disappointing news can trigger a sell-off, creating downward pressure. Keep an eye on major economic indicators released before the open, such as GDP figures, inflation data, or employment reports. These releases can set the tone for the day and cause considerable volatility. Trading volumes are typically lower in the pre-market, which can lead to exaggerated price movements. Be cautious when interpreting these early signals, as they may not always accurately predict the day's overall trend. It's also worth noting any major geopolitical events or international market movements that occur overnight. European and Asian markets can often provide clues about how U.S. markets might react at the open. Staying informed about these global factors can give you a more comprehensive view of the market landscape. Following financial news outlets and using pre-market trading tools can help you stay on top of these early developments. By carefully analyzing pre-market activity, you can better prepare for the trading day and make more informed investment decisions.

Key Factors Influencing the Market Open

Several factors can significantly influence the stock market open news. Economic data releases, such as inflation reports, unemployment figures, and GDP growth, play a pivotal role. Better-than-expected data can boost investor confidence, leading to a positive market open, while disappointing figures can trigger concerns and lead to a sell-off. Corporate earnings reports are another major catalyst. When companies announce their financial results, especially industry leaders, it can set the tone for the entire market. Positive earnings and strong guidance often lead to increased buying pressure, while negative surprises can cause stocks to tumble. Geopolitical events also have a significant impact. International conflicts, political instability, and trade tensions can create uncertainty and volatility in the market. For example, news of a major trade agreement can boost market sentiment, while escalating tensions can lead to risk aversion and a flight to safety. Interest rate decisions by central banks, such as the Federal Reserve, are closely watched. Changes in interest rates can affect borrowing costs, corporate profitability, and overall economic growth. A rate cut can stimulate the economy and boost stock prices, while a rate hike can have the opposite effect. Additionally, major news events, such as unexpected political developments or significant policy changes, can also influence the market open. These events can create uncertainty and lead to rapid price swings. Investor sentiment, which is often driven by news and expectations, also plays a crucial role. Positive sentiment can drive buying activity, while negative sentiment can lead to increased selling pressure. Keeping an eye on these key factors and understanding their potential impact can help you anticipate market movements and make informed trading decisions.

Sector Performance at the Open

Understanding sector performance at the stock market open news can provide valuable insights into broader market trends. Different sectors often react differently to economic news and events, making it essential to monitor their individual performance. For example, the technology sector is often sensitive to interest rate changes and innovation trends, while the energy sector is closely tied to oil prices and geopolitical developments. Financial stocks can be influenced by interest rates and regulatory changes, while consumer discretionary stocks are often driven by consumer spending and confidence levels. At the market open, some sectors may show early strength, while others may lag. Identifying these trends can help you understand which areas of the market are attracting investor interest and which are facing headwinds. For instance, if the technology sector is leading the market higher, it could indicate strong confidence in future growth and innovation. Conversely, if the energy sector is underperforming, it might reflect concerns about oil prices or global demand. Monitoring sector performance can also help you identify potential investment opportunities. If a particular sector is showing strong relative strength, it could be a sign that it is poised for further gains. On the other hand, if a sector is consistently underperforming, it might be a warning sign to avoid or reduce exposure. To track sector performance effectively, use financial news websites, market data platforms, and sector-specific ETFs. These resources can provide real-time updates on sector performance and help you stay informed about the latest trends. Analyzing sector performance at the market open can provide a more nuanced understanding of market dynamics and inform your investment decisions.

How to React to Market Opening Volatility

The stock market open news often brings significant volatility, and knowing how to react is crucial for protecting your investments and capitalizing on opportunities. Volatility at the open can be driven by a variety of factors, including economic data releases, corporate earnings reports, and unexpected news events. One of the most important things to do is to remain calm and avoid making impulsive decisions based on short-term price swings. Instead, stick to your pre-defined investment strategy and consider using tools like stop-loss orders to limit potential losses. It's also important to avoid chasing momentum. Just because a stock or sector is up significantly at the open doesn't mean it will continue to rise throughout the day. Similarly, a sharp decline at the open doesn't necessarily mean a stock is destined for further losses. Consider using a dollar-cost averaging strategy, where you invest a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of market conditions. This can help you avoid timing the market and reduce the risk of buying high and selling low. It's also a good idea to diversify your portfolio across different asset classes and sectors. This can help reduce your overall risk and cushion the impact of volatility in any one area of the market. Stay informed about market news and events, but be careful not to overreact to every headline. Focus on the long-term fundamentals of your investments and avoid getting caught up in short-term noise. By staying disciplined and informed, you can navigate market opening volatility effectively and protect your portfolio.
